Amid the difference of opinions in TDP-Janasena alliance seat sharing and YSRCP launching its full-on campaign ahead of the elections, the heat in AP politics is high on many levels.
While the Janasena and TDP meeting is all set and the alliance supporters are eagerly waiting for what Chandrababu and Pawan Kalyan will speak about tomorrow, AP CM YS Jagan spoke at Siddham today.
YS Jagan alleges that the opposition and rivals are trying to make it a caste war, but it is a class war that is happening here. Stating that he has done whatever he could do so far, Jagan leaves the responsibility on the YSRCP party cadre and leaders to make the party win in the upcoming polls.
Mentioning the welfare he has done for the state, Jagan further states that he has given the power and weapons that no other politician or party could ever give to the party leaders. Jagan says it is the responsibility of the leaders to relentlessly campaign in the next 45 days and make the party win.
Reiterating the need for YSRCP’s win in the upcoming elections, Jagan asks why not Kuppam and Ichhapuram as he hopes YSRCP to win all 175 MLA seats and 25 MPs.
